St. Theresa School (Closed 2000)

St. Theresa School in Briarcliff Manor, New York was founded in 1965 and is the Parochial Elementary School of St.
Theresa Parish. St. Theresa School provides a Catholic education for children in Pre-Kindergarten through Grade Eight who reside in Briarcliff Manor and surrounding school districts.
